WebTwo-dimensional lists (arrays) Theory. Steps. Problems. 1. Nested lists: processing and printing. In real-world Often tasks have to store rectangular data table. [say more on this!] Such tables are called matrices or two-dimensional arrays. In Python any table can be represented as a list of lists (a list, where each element is in turn a list). WebSlicing 2-D Arrays Example Get your own Python Server From the second element, slice elements from index 1 to index 4 (not included): import numpy as np arr = np.array ( [ [1, 2, 3, 4, 5], [6, 7, 8, 9, 10]]) print(arr [1, 1:4]) Try it Yourself » Note: Remember that second element has index 1. Web2 days ago · The del statement can also be used to remove slices from a list or clear the entire list (which we did earlier by assignment of an empty list to the slice). For example: >>> >>> a = [-1, 1, 66.25, 333, 333, 1234.5] >>> del a[0] >>> a [1, 66.25, 333, 333, 1234.5] >>> del a[2:4] >>> a [1, 66.25, 1234.5] >>> del a[:] >>> a []
